Warner Brothers Interactive Cuts 60 In Seattle
Warner Brothers Interactive
has cut 60 people in its Seattle area game studios,
according
to a report today from Joystiq. Warner Brothers Interactive's Seattle studios include Snowblind Studios, Monolith Productions and Surreal Software. Joystiq, citing a statement from a Warner Brothers spokesperson, said the cuts came due to "fluctuating market conditions".
